Realistic Reconstruction of Human Face Based on Images

Abstract:This paper presents a reconstruction algorithm for 3D realistic facial model based on facial images. In this algorithm, the camera is calibrated according to its field of view and manual labeled feature points. The dense corresponding points on the two facial images are matched using a semi _automatic method to carry out 3D reconstruction. Firstly, the initial face shape is gained by editing 2D corresponding mesh manually. Secondly, a robust maximum likelihood stereo matching algorithm is used to get dense corresponding points, and recover their 3D positions. Lastly, the 3D initial facial mesh is subdivided adaptively according to the distribution density of 3D points to construct the resulting model. To remove the reconstruct noise, second order Laplace operator is used to smooth the model. The result model is decorated by texture mapping. Experiments show that the algorithm is simple and can generate very realistic facial expression without expensive devices.
